The Benefits of Fractional Ownership of FarmsFractional ownership of farms provides farmers with the opportunity to own a share of the farm while still benefiting from the management and operation of the land. It also allows the farmer to sell or lease their share of the farm to other farmers, which can provide them with additional income and allow them to continue farming in a sustainable way. Additionally, fractional ownership of farms can help to improve agricultural productivity and reduce environmental impact.
